[ARCHIVE]Toute question de débutant, afin de ne pas encombrer le forum. Professionnels, ne passez pas à côté. Je ne peux aller nulle part sans toi - 5. - page 168

 

OrderMagicNumber() est un attribut ou une propriété de chaque commande.

k0rwin:

Je me risque à répéter ma question :
C'est-à-dire, l'essence de la question : les magies sont-elles sauvegardées après la fermeture du terminal/expert et y a-t-il un moyen de les restaurer ?

 

Quoi de neuf les gars. J'ai posé une question : quelle est la différence entre la démo et la version originale du film muet, à l'exception de Boris, et ce, sous une forme incompréhensible et dure ? Allez, enseignez au débutant, parlez-nous de vos secrets.

Sincèrement, Oleg

 
lemesev66:

Quoi de neuf les gars. J'ai posé une question : quelle est la différence entre la démo et la version originale du film muet, à l'exception de Boris, et ce, sous une forme incompréhensible et dure ? Allez, enseignez au débutant, parlez-nous de vos secrets.

Sincèrement, Oleg

Quelle est la différence entre une question de démonstration et une question normale ? Quelle est la différence entre l'argent de démonstration et l'argent brut ? La question est la même que la réponse. Ai-je levé le voile du secret pour vous ?

Quelle est la démo dans votre question ? Original - qu'y a-t-il d'original ? Ne posez pas de questions floues à des personnes qui ont l'habitude de travailler avec une logique claire...

 

Artyom a disparu, peut-être qu'un des pros sait s'il est possible de vérifier les paramètres de l'avant-dernière position ouverte avec la fonction ! Si c'est possible, bien sûr ! Merci !

Je retire la question, car j'ai trouvé une solution simple pour l'indice. Quand on apprend, on apprend toujours quelque chose pour la première fois, comme au premier cours. :)

 

Comment déterminer la cotation utilisée par un courtier à 4 ou 5 chiffres, quelqu'un a-t-il un algorithme ?

Si 0,0001, l'EA fonctionne avec des cotations à 4 chiffres et le TakeProfit est fixé à 30 pips. Si 0,00001, l'EA fonctionne avec des cotations à 5 chiffres et le TakeProfit est fixé à 300 pips.

 
pasha5282:

Comment déterminer la cotation utilisée par un courtier à 4 ou 5 chiffres, quelqu'un a-t-il un algorithme ?

Si 0,0001, l'EA fonctionne avec des cotations à 4 chiffres et le TakeProfit est fixé à 30 pips. Si 0,00001, l'EA fonctionne avec des cotations à 5 chiffres et le TakeProfit est fixé à 300 pips.



si(Chiffres==3|Chiffres==5) TakeProfit *=10 ;
 

Salut !

Le logiciel est une vraie plaie :


#property indicator_separate_window
#property indicator_minimum -2
#property indicator_maximum 2
//--- input parameters
extern int       iBarsToProcess = 20;
//--------------------------------------------------------------------------------------------------------------------+
double   fract_buf[];
//+------------------------------------------------------------------+
//| Custom indicator initialization function                         |
//+------------------------------------------------------------------+
int init()
  {
   SetIndexStyle(0,DRAW_LINE);
   SetIndexBuffer(0, fract_buf);
   return(0);
  }
//+------------------------------------------------------------------+
//| Custom indicator deinitialization function                       |
//+------------------------------------------------------------------+
int deinit()
  {
//----
   
//----
   return(0);
  }
//+------------------------------------------------------------------+
//| Custom indicator iteration function                              |
//+------------------------------------------------------------------+
int start()
{
   int counted_bars = IndicatorCounted();
   int limit;
   if(counted_bars > 0)
   counted_bars--;
   limit = Bars - counted_bars;
   if(limit > iBarsToProcess)
         limit = iBarsToProcess;
   
   for (int i = 0; i < limit; i++)
   {
      Print("i = ", i);
      Print ("Upper = ", iFractals(0, 0, MODE_UPPER, 0));
      Print ("Lower = ", iFractals(0, 0, MODE_LOWER, 0));
   }

   return(0);
}
//+------------------------------------------------------------------+



N'imprime que des zéros dans le journal, mais sur le graphique, beaucoup de fractales dans les vingt premières mesures. Quelle est l'astuce ? Qui sait ? Au départ, l'indicateur était destiné à imprimer des fractales. Puis print() a produit ceci,

12:28:17 is EURUSD,Daily: loaded successfully
12:28:18 is EURUSD,Daily: initialized
12:28:18 is EURUSD,Daily: i = 0
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 1
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 2
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 3
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 4
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 5
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 6
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 7
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 8
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 9
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 10
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 11
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 12
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 13
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 14
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 15
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 16
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 17
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 18
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 19
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 0
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 1
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 0
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:18 is EURUSD,Daily: i = 1
12:28:18 is EURUSD,Daily: Upper = 0
12:28:18 is EURUSD,Daily: Lower = 0
12:28:19 is EURUSD,Daily: i = 0
12:28:19 is EURUSD,Daily: Upper = 0
12:28:19 is EURUSD,Daily: Lower = 0
12:28:19 is EURUSD,Daily: i = 1
12:28:19 is EURUSD,Daily: Upper = 0
12:28:19 is EURUSD,Daily: Lower = 0
12:28:19 is EURUSD,Daily: i = 0
12:28:19 is EURUSD,Daily: Upper = 0
12:28:19 is EURUSD,Daily: Lower = 0
12:28:19 is EURUSD,Daily: i = 1
12:28:19 is EURUSD,Daily: Upper = 0
12:28:19 is EURUSD,Daily: Lower = 0
12:28:20 is EURUSD,Daily: i = 0
12:28:20 is EURUSD,Daily: Upper = 0
12:28:20 is EURUSD,Daily: Lower = 0
12:28:20 is EURUSD,Daily: i = 1
12:28:20 is EURUSD,Daily: Upper = 0
12:28:20 is EURUSD,Daily: Lower = 0
12:28:21 is EURUSD,Daily: i = 0
12:28:21 is EURUSD,Daily: Upper = 0
12:28:21 is EURUSD,Daily: Lower = 0
12:28:21 is EURUSD,Daily: i = 1
12:28:21 is EURUSD,Daily: Upper = 0
12:28:21 is EURUSD,Daily: Lower = 0
12:28:21 is EURUSD,Daily: i = 0
12:28:21 is EURUSD,Daily: Upper = 0
12:28:21 is EURUSD,Daily: Lower = 0
12:28:21 is EURUSD,Daily: i = 1
12:28:21 is EURUSD,Daily: Upper = 0
12:28:21 is EURUSD,Daily: Lower = 0
12:28:22 is EURUSD,Daily: i = 0
12:28:22 is EURUSD,Daily: Upper = 0
12:28:22 is EURUSD,Daily: Lower = 0
12:28:22 is EURUSD,Daily: i = 1
12:28:22 is EURUSD,Daily: Upper = 0
12:28:22 is EURUSD,Daily: Lower = 0
12:28:22 is EURUSD,Daily: i = 0
12:28:22 is EURUSD,Daily: Upper = 0
12:28:22 is EURUSD,Daily: Lower = 0
12:28:22 is EURUSD,Daily: i = 1
12:28:22 is EURUSD,Daily: Upper = 0
12:28:22 is EURUSD,Daily: Lower = 0
12:28:22 is EURUSD,Daily: i = 0
12:28:22 is EURUSD,Daily: Upper = 0
12:28:22 is EURUSD,Daily: Lower = 0
12:28:22 is EURUSD,Daily: i = 1
12:28:22 is EURUSD,Daily: Upper = 0
12:28:22 is EURUSD,Daily: Lower = 0
12:28:23 is EURUSD,Daily: deinitialized
12:28:23 is EURUSD,Daily: uninit reason 1
12:28:23 is EURUSD,Daily: removed



Bien sûr, il y a des fractales sur le graphique. Lorsque vous passez la souris sur la flèche, la valeur s'affiche. Aidez-moi à résoudre ce problème.

 
Al_Key:

Salut !

N'imprime que des zéros dans le journal, mais sur le graphique, beaucoup de fractales dans les vingt premières mesures. Quel est le problème ? Qui sait ? Au départ, l'indicateur était censé pouvoir suivre les fractales. Puis print() m'a donné ceci :

Bien sûr, il y a des fractales sur le graphique. Lorsque vous passez la souris sur la flèche, la valeur s'affiche. Veuillez m'aider à résoudre ce problème.

D'abord, écrivez-le comme ceci :

    iFractals (NULL, 0, MODE_UPPER, 0);
 
TarasBY:

Commencez par l'écrire comme ceci :


C'est vrai... Je le fais de cette façon depuis le début (selon l'aide). J'ai vérifié à nouveau juste au cas où, aucun changement.
 
Al_Key:

C'est vrai... C'est ce que je fais depuis le début (selon l'aide). J'ai vérifié à nouveau juste au cas où, aucun changement.

Et deuxièmement, mettez l'indice de la barre sur laquelle vous cherchez une fractale :

    for (int i = 0; i < limit; i++)
    {
       Print ("i = ", i);
       Print ("Upper = ", iFractals (NULL, 0, MODE_UPPER, i));
       Print ("Lower = ", iFractals (NULL, 0, MODE_LOWER, i));
    }